Abstract
1,205,852. Carbon fibre reinforced resins. BP CHEMICALS (U.K.) Ltd. 11 June, 1969 [26 June, 1968], No. 30615/68. Heading B5A. [Also in Division C7] Carbon fibres, e.g. in the form of hanks or twists of multi-filament strands, woven mats or fabrics, which may contain fibres other than of carbon (e.g. glass), are coated with one or more ionizable resins by electrodeposition to produce carbon fibre reinforced plastics articles. The ionizable resin is preferably a phenolic or thermosetting acrylic resin, but may be any addition copolymer or polycondensation product, e.g. unsaturated maleinized drying oil, epoxide or alkyd resin, or phenol or melamine formaldehyde resin, and contain -COOH, -SO 4 H, -SO 3 H and -OPO(OH) 2 anionic, or -N(R 3 )<SP>+</SP>Cl<SP>-</SP>, -NH 3 <SP>+</SP>Cl<SP>-</SP> or quaternary ammonium cationic groups. The coated fibres may be formed into the reinforced article in the absence of further plastics material, or may be dispersed in a different thermoplastic or thermosetting resin, e.g. comprising unsaturated polyester such as formed by interesterification of a (e.g. neopentyl) glycol, phthalic or trimellitic and maleic anhydride. Coating is preferably carried out in an aqueous medium containing a resin having carboxyl groups neutralized with ammonia and feeding the fibre over phosphor bronze strips. Two or more coats may be applied by successive immersions. The coated fibre may be hot pressed to give a cured laminate. For example, dried tows of coated fibres may be soaked in an epoxy resin solution, then transferred to a " leaky " mould which, with the plunger top pressed down and surplus resin allowed to drain away, is oven heated and cured at 125‹ C.
